9 Daniel Street, Granville NSW 2142

Description
Proposed childcare centre including retention of the existing “heritage” building on the site fronting Daniel Street and alterations and additions to the existing building including a basement car parking level.

I am strongly against this proposal. Preserving a heritage building while introducing constant commercial use, underground excavation, and daily traffic incompatible with a reasonably quiet residential street, destroys the very context that gives this heritage meaning. Daniel Street and surrounding areas (particularly The Avenue) form a cohesive heritage precinct of family residences. A commercial daycare center represents an incompatible land use that will generate daily traffic and parking pressure during peak drop-off and pick-up times (starting as early as 7am and finishing as late as 6pm), introduce noise and activity levels that are at odds with residential amenity, and will require underground excavation that risks structural damage to neighbouring heritage properties. This will also establish a precedent for further commercial encroachment in a residential area and undermine the established character that warrants heritage listing in the first place.
